SUSE Manager 4.3 Server Deployment as a Virtual Machine - VMware

This chapter provides the required Virtual Machine settings for deployment of SUSE Manager 4.3 as an Image. VMware will be used as a sandbox for this installation.

1. Available Images

The preferred method for deploying SUSE Manager 4.3 Server is to use one of the following available images. All tools are included in these images greatly simplifying deployment.

Images for SUSE Manager 4.3 are available at SUSE Manager 4.3 VM images.

Customized SUSE Manager 4.3 VM images are provided only for SL Micro 6.1. To run the product on SUSE Linux Enterprise Server {bci-mlm}, use the standard SUSE Linux Enterprise Server {bci-mlm} installation media available at https://www.suse.com/download/sles/ and enable the SUSE Manager 4.3 extensions on top of it.

2. SUSE Manager Virtual Machine Settings - VMware

This sections describes VMware configurations, focusing on the creation of an extra virtual disk essential for the SUSE Manager storage partition within VMware environments.

Procedure: Creating the VMware Virtual Machine
  1. Download SUSE Manager Server .vmdk file then transfer a copy to your VMware storage.

  2. Make a copy of uploaded .vmdk file using VMware web interface. This will convert provided .vmdk file to the format suitable for vSphere hypervisor.

  3. Create and name a new virtual machine based on the Guest OS Family Linux and Guest OS Version SUSE Linux Enterprise 15 (64-bit).

+

  1. Add an additional Hard Disk 2 of 500 GB (or more).

  2. Configure RAM and number of CPUs with minimum values. *)

  3. Set the network adapter as required.

  4. Power on the VM, and follow firstboot dialogs (keyboard layout, license agreement, time zone, password for root).

  5. When installation completes log in as root.

  6. Proceed to the next section.

3. Register SL Micro and SUSE Manager 4.3 Server

Before starting obtain your SUSE Manager Registration Code from {scclongform} - https://scc.suse.com.

The SL Micro 6.1 entitlement is included within the SUSE Manager entitlement, so it does not require a separate registration code.

SUSE Manager server hosts that are hardened for security may restrict execution of files from the /tmp folder. In such cases, as a workaround, export the TMPDIR environment variable to another existing path before running mgradm.

For example:

export TMPDIR=/path/to/other/tmp

In SUSE Manager updates, tools will be changed to make this workaround unnecessary.

Procedure: Registering SL Micro and SUSE Manager 4.3
  1. Boot the virtual machine.

  2. Log in as root.

  3. Register SL Micro with SUSE Customer Center.

    transactional-update register -r <REGCODE> -e <your_email>
  4. Reboot.

  5. Register SUSE Manager 4.3 with {scclongform}.

    transactional-update register -p Multi-Linux-Manager-Server/5.1/x86_64 -r <REGCODE>
  6. Reboot

  7. Update the system:

    transactional-update
  8. If updates were applied reboot.

  9. This step is optional. However, if custom persistent storage is required for your infrastructure, use the mgr-storage-server tool.

    For more information, see mgr-storage-server --help. This tool simplifies creating the container storage and database volumes. Use the command in the following manner:

    mgr-storage-server <storage-disk-device> [<database-disk-device>]

    For example:

    mgr-storage-server /dev/nvme1n1 /dev/nvme2n1

    This command will create the persistent storage volumes at /var/lib/containers/storage/volumes.

  10. Deploy SUSE Manager.

    If you use VM images as a migration target, here as the last step, execute the command mgradm migrate instead of mgradm install.

    Execute one of the following commands, depending on the SSL certificate variant (self-signed or third-party). Replace <FQDN> with your fully qualified domain name of the SUSE Manager Server:

    • Using self-signed certificates provided by SUSE Manager:

      mgradm install podman <FQDN>
    • With importing SSL certificates using third-party SSL certificate flags (the example can adjusted if not all these certificates are needed):

      mgradm install podman <FQDN> \
        --ssl-ca-intermediate <strings> \
        --ssl-ca-root <string> \
        --ssl-server-cert <string> \
        --ssl-server-key <string> \
        --ssl-db-ca-intermediate <strings> \
        --ssl-db-ca-root <string> \
        --ssl-db-cert <string> \
        --ssl-db-key <string>

      For more information, see mgradm install podman --help.
